Big Second Half Fuels Warriors Past D-III Birmingham-Southern

BIRMINGHAM, Ala. (August 28, 2022) - The Webber International University women's soccer team earned its second victory in three days to start the 2022 season after defeating Division-III Birmingham-Southern, 4-2, on Sunday afternoon.

Following their 1-0 victory over Brewton-Parker College on Friday, the Warriors (2-0 overall) traveled to Birmingham, Alabama to face the Panthers of Birmingham-Southern (0-1).

The Panthers would strike first with the only goal of the first half, via a penalty kick just over eight minutes into the match. BSC would hold its one goal lead throughout the remainder of the first half. The Warriors would come out of the halftime break strong, as less than three minutes into the second half, Brazil Clark would find the back of the net off of a pass from Hayden Rupe. Roughly eight minutes later, Rupe would go from provider to goal scorer as she would gift Webber a 2-1 lead.

In the 59th minute, a pass from Hannah Esson would find Faith Cullen-Cooper who would fire it past the keeper to double the Warriors' lead. Birmingham-Southern would pull back within one after a goal in the 64th minute. Just under five minutes later, the Warriors would restore their two-goal advantage by way of sophomore-midfielder Lucia De La Llera. Webber would take a 4-2 lead and solid defense for the remainder of the second half would see them take the victory over the Panthers.

The Warriors would have four different goal scorers in the match, with B. Clark getting her second goal in as many games to start the season. Rupe would lead the way offensively with a goal and an assist. It would be the first goals of the season for Rupe, Cullen-Cooper, and De La Llera.

Webber now has a roughly two week break before its next match which will take place on Saturday, September 10th, when they travel to take on Ohio Christian University before then traveling to Kentucky to battle the University of Pikeville Bears the very next day, Sunday, September 11th.
